Google released Gemini 3.6 Flash on July 21. On August 13 — just 22 days later — it released Gemini 3.7 Flash at half the price. The message is clear: Google is not waiting for competitors to catch up. It is outrunning itself.

Gemini 3.7 Flash arrives with introductory pricing of $0.75 per million input tokens and $3.75 per million output tokens, exactly half what 3.6 Flash cost at launch. The standard price of $1.50/$7.50 returns January 1, 2027, but for the rest of the year, developers get Google's most capable work model at a price that undercuts every major competitor.

For businesses building AI agents, this creates an unusual window: frontier-grade capability at commodity pricing. The catch is that the window closes in four months.

What Makes Gemini 3.7 Flash Different

Google describes 3.7 Flash as its "most intelligent workhorse model yet for coding and agents." The improvements over 3.6 Flash target three areas: software engineering, knowledge work, and web development workflows.

The model builds on the efficiency gains that defined 3.6 Flash — 17% fewer output tokens than 3.5 Flash, with up to 65% savings on long-horizon coding tasks — and adds higher precision across these workloads. Google credits developer feedback and algorithmic innovations for the rapid improvement cycle.

For developers already using 3.6 Flash, the upgrade path is straightforward. The model supports the same 1 million token context window, 64K maximum output, and natively processes text, images, audio, video, and PDFs. The API integration is identical — swap the model identifier and the pricing changes automatically.

Pricing Breakdown: 3.7 Flash vs the Market

The introductory pricing positions Gemini 3.7 Flash as the most cost-effective model in its class. Here is how it compares to current alternatives:

Model Input (per 1M) Output (per 1M) Provider
Gemini 3.7 Flash (intro) $0.75 $3.75 Google
Gemini 3.6 Flash $1.50 $7.50 Google
Gemini 3.5 Flash-Lite $0.30 $2.50 Google
Grok 4.6 $2.00 $6.00 xAI
GPT-5.4 $2.00 $10.00 OpenAI
Qwen3.7-Max $2.50 $7.50 Alibaba
GPT-5.6 Terra $2.50 $15.00 OpenAI

The math is compelling. A developer running 100,000 agentic tasks per month with an average of 2,000 output tokens each would pay approximately $750 per month on 3.7 Flash's introductory pricing. The same workload on GPT-5.4 would cost $4,000 — a 5.3x difference. Even after January 2027 when standard pricing kicks in, 3.7 Flash at $1.50/$7.50 matches 3.6 Flash's current price with improved capability.

Where 3.7 Flash Fits in Google's Model Lineup

Google now offers four tiers of Gemini models, each optimized for different use cases:

Model Best For Input Price Output Price
3.7 Flash Coding agents, knowledge work, web dev $0.75 (intro) $3.75 (intro)
3.6 Flash General agentic tasks, multimodal $1.50 $7.50
3.5 Flash-Lite High-throughput, simple tasks, AI Overviews $0.30 $2.50
3.1 Pro Preview Maximum reasoning, complex analysis $2.00 $12.00

The strategic pattern is obvious: Google is building a model for every price point and performance tier. Flash-Lite handles volume at the bottom. 3.7 Flash captures the high-value middle ground where most agentic workloads land. Pro Preview serves the premium tier where reasoning depth matters more than cost.

For developers choosing between models, the decision framework is straightforward. If the task requires deep reasoning, multi-step analysis, or complex problem solving — use Pro. If it requires reliable execution at scale — use 3.7 Flash. If it requires maximum throughput at minimum cost — use Flash-Lite.

What This Means for the AI API Market

Google's pricing strategy with 3.7 Flash creates pressure across the industry. At $0.75 per million input tokens, the model undercuts OpenAI's GPT-5.4 by 62% on input costs and GPT-5.6 Terra by 70%. It undercuts xAI's Grok 4.6 by 62% on input while matching its output price.

The competitive dynamics shift further when considering token efficiency. If 3.7 Flash delivers on Google's claims of improved coding and agentic performance over 3.6 Flash — which itself used 17% fewer tokens than 3.5 Flash — the effective cost advantage widens. Fewer tokens per task at a lower per-token price compounds into significant savings at scale.

The Three-Week Cycle: What It Signals

The 22-day gap between 3.6 Flash and 3.7 Flash is unusual even by Google's standards. Previous Flash model updates spanned months. The compressed timeline suggests several things:

Developer feedback is driving faster iteration. Google explicitly credits developer feedback for 3.7 Flash's improvements. The company appears to be shipping updates as quickly as it can integrate feedback, rather than waiting for scheduled release cycles.

Price competition has intensified. The half-price introductory offer is not just a product launch — it is a market share play. By undercutting competitors while simultaneously improving capability, Google is making it economically irrational for developers to use rival models for agentic workloads.

Google is prioritizing the workhorse tier. While competitors focus on flagship models that push reasoning boundaries, Google is investing heavily in the mid-tier models that handle the majority of production workloads. The Flash series is where volume, cost, and capability intersect — and Google wants to own that intersection.

What is the difference between Gemini 3.7 Flash and 3.6 Flash?

Gemini 3.7 Flash delivers improved software engineering, knowledge work, and web development performance over 3.6 Flash. The introductory price is exactly half ($0.75/$3.75 vs $1.50/$7.50 per million tokens). Both models share the same 1M context window, 64K max output, and multimodal capabilities. Google credits algorithmic innovations and developer feedback for the improvements.

How much does Gemini 3.7 Flash cost?

Until December 31, 2026, Gemini 3.7 Flash costs $0.75 per million input tokens and $3.75 per million output tokens. Starting January 1, 2027, standard pricing of $1.50 per million input tokens and $7.50 per million output tokens applies. Is Gemini 3.7 Flash good for coding agents?

Google specifically positions 3.7 Flash as optimized for coding and agentic workflows. It builds on 3.6 Flash's improvements (DeepSWE: 49% vs 37% for 3.5 Flash, MLE-Bench: 63.9% vs 49.7%) with further precision gains. The model handles complex code generation, debugging, and multi-step development tasks with lower compile-failure and revision rates.

When does the introductory pricing end?

The introductory pricing of $0.75/$3.75 per million tokens expires on December 31, 2026. Starting January 1, 2027, standard pricing of $1.50/$7.50 per million tokens applies. Developers building long-term production systems should plan for the price increase when calculating project costs.
